**Deploy step 4 — log sampling for Chatterlane.** The Chatterlane ingest service emits roughly 40k lines per minute at peak, so before promoting to prod, enable sampled logging at a 1:50 ratio and confirm the sampler ships aggregate counts to Hushboard. Verify the ratio in staging for at least one full traffic cycle. Then, in the service env file, add the sampler's signing credential on the next line.

sealed setting: VAULT_KEY20=c8ea1e419912889df6b4

### v2.8.1 — Tax-rate lookup cache

Heads up: the Coppergate tax-rate cache now refreshes every 30 minutes instead of nightly, so stale-rate complaints should drop off. If you're new here, don't bypass the cache with direct lookups — it hammers the Ratesmith API and we get throttled. Warm-up on deploy is automatic now. Any cache weirdness, ping the maintainer named below.

approver of faduf-bagug = Framir Sorwyn

## Auth notes

The Larkspun session-refresh bug (stale tokens accepted for up to 90 seconds after expiry) is reproducible only against the Dunmow staging gateway. To reproduce: authenticate, wait for expiry, then replay the last request. Contractors get a scoped staging credential — never use personal accounts. For the repro script, authenticate with the token below.

session JWT of yawep-yawep = eyJhbGciOiJIUzI1NiIsInR5cCI6IkpXVCJ9.eyJzdWIiOiI3pWF3_In0.aXYsHiog

Subject: Autocomplete cut-over complete

Hi,

The switch from the legacy lookup to the Pinwheel address autocomplete widget finished last night. Traffic moved over in two stages with no error spikes. Latency dropped roughly 30% on suggestion calls, and the old endpoint is now read-only pending decommission. For your records, the widget now runs with the configuration values below.

config for bawif-kahog:
FRAAX_PIN=2783
FRAAX_METRICS_HOST=metrics.fraax.qirvansys.internal
FRAAX_LOG_LEVEL=error
FRAAX_TENANT=istax